Protein-Protein Interface Analysis & Hotspot Prediction Skill
Modes
Mode A — Interface Analysis (CPU, ~2–10 min)
Given a PDB file (experimental or predicted):
- Interface residues via BSA differential
- Contact map (Cα–Cα < 8Å, heavy atom < 5Å)
- Computational alanine scanning — SASA-proxy for ΔΔG
- Hotspot ranking (BSA ≥ 25 Ų = predicted hotspot)
- H-bond and salt bridge detection
- Shape complementarity proxy
Mode B — Complex Prediction (GPU recommended, ~5–30 min)
Given two amino acid sequences, predict the heterodimer using ColabFold AlphaFold2-Multimer v3, then automatically run Mode A on the top-ranked model.
Mode C — De Novo Binder Design (GPU required)
FreeBindCraft hallucination of novel binders against target. See ppi_pipeline.py for full implementation.

Scientific Basis
- Hotspot definition: ΔΔG_bind ≥ 2.0 kcal/mol upon Ala mutation (Bogan & Thorn 1998)
- SASA-based proxy correlates ~0.6 with experimental alanine scanning (Moreira et al. 2007)
- Shape complementarity: Sc > 0.65 = well-packed interface (Lawrence & Colman 1993)
- ipTM > 0.75 = high-confidence interface prediction (ColabFold)
